Supported Hardware for Quantization Kernels
|
|
===========================================
|
|
|
|
The table below shows the compatibility of various quantization implementations with different hardware platforms in vLLM:
|
|
|
|
===================== ====== ======= ======= ===== ====== ======= ========= ======= ============== ==========
|
|
Implementation Volta Turing Ampere Ada Hopper AMD GPU Intel GPU x86 CPU AWS Inferentia Google TPU
|
|
===================== ====== ======= ======= ===== ====== ======= ========= ======= ============== ==========
|
|
AWQ ❌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
GPTQ 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
Marlin (GPTQ/AWQ/FP8) ❌ ❌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
INT8 (W8A8) ❌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
FP8 (W8A8) ❌ ❌ ❌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
AQLM 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
bitsandbytes 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
DeepSpeedFP 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
GGUF 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
SqueezeLLM ✅ ✅ ✅ ✅ ✅ ❌ ❌ ❌ ❌ ❌
|
|
===================== ====== ======= ======= ===== ====== ======= ========= ======= ============== ==========
|
|
|
|
Notes:
|
|
^^^^^^
|
|
|
|
- Volta refers to SM 7.0, Turing to SM 7.5, Ampere to SM 8.0/8.6, Ada to SM 8.9, and Hopper to SM 9.0.
|
|
- "✅" indicates that the quantization method is supported on the specified hardware.
|
|
- "❌" indicates that the quantization method is not supported on the specified hardware.
|
|
|
|
Please note that this compatibility chart may be subject to change as vLLM continues to evolve and expand its support for different hardware platforms and quantization methods.
